Students in Foss Studios York apartments of Hello Student Property can enjoy easy transportation access both around York and within the broader area. Bus users will have The Barbican bus station just 8 minutes walk away from the apartments, while Merchantgate (station Pc) can be accessed in just a short walk of 9 minutes. Students using the train can access the York Train Station, which is just 8 minutes drive from the apartments. Another train station available in the area for train users is Poppleton Train Station, which is about 18 minutes drive away from the apartment. Students who use air travel will have Rufforth Airfield East about 21 minutes drive from the apartments. An advance payment of £250 is required to secure the room. This amount must be paid online during the booking process via card. It will be adjusted against the first rent payment and is non-refundable.
Debit card Direct debit Bank transfer Cash not accepted. Cheque not accepted.
Required only if paying in instalments. Guarantor must: Be over 25 years old. Can be based in the UK or overseas. Agree to cover rent if tenant fails to pay. If no guarantor: Can use third-party guarantor service (e.g., Housing Hand).
4 instalments: 10% in August, due on 3rd August (required before move-in). 30% in September, due on 23rd September 40% in January, due on 8th January 20% in April, due on 9th April
